New York Giants @ Chicago Cubs

1952-08-21 Β· Day game Β· Wrigley Field Β· Att: 15630 Β· 2:55

New York Giants defeated Chicago Cubs 10–5. New York Giants put up 4 in the 6th. Bill Connelly earned the win and Hoyt Wilhelm picked up the save. Dusty Rhodes went 2-for-5 with 3 RBI.
